Albert Wallwick Dilling (1892 - June 1969) of Chicago was an engineer and an attorney. He was once married to Elizabeth Dilling an anti-Communist author and defendant in the Great Sedition Trial of 1944. During the trial Albert Dilling defended his ex-wife; they divorced in October 1943.

Albert Dilling was born in Salt Lake City, Utah of Norwegian parents. He married Elizabeth Eloise Kirkpatrick in the summer on 1918. They had two children: a son Kirkpatrick, born in 1920, and a daughter Elizabeth Jane born in 1925.
